Fire was the main development. With fire they could cook meat and with the higher protein the brain developed to a higher degree than the animals they hunted. Fire also provided a means for community and better communication developed and fire gave warmth . The next development was learning to grow crops. Instead of a nomadic life people could settle in communities for trade, protection, and grow food. With more food and people came the need for government, religion, and buildings. Art was developed, music created, and people domesticated animals.

Why a production possibility is concave?

A production possibility curve is concave because of the law of diminishing returns. As more resources are allocated to one good over the other, the opportunity cost increases, which leads to decreasing marginal rates of substitution. This results in a concave curve that shows the trade-off between producing different goods.
